A rare opportunity to own a truly special single-family townhouse in the heart of Williamsburg. Custom built and thoughtfully renovated, this turn-key home offers a warm, design-forward take on Brooklyn living, blending natural materials, understated luxury, and an easy indoor-outdoor flow. Tucked behind a private ground-floor entrance, the house opens into a bright and expansive main level defined by wide-plank wood floors, exposed timber elements, soft tones, and an open layout that feels both refined and relaxed. At the center of the home is a striking chef’s kitchen with richly textured wood cabinetry, a large center island with seating, qu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, and a clean modern backsplash. The kitchen flows seamlessly into the living and dining areas, where the design feels casual yet elevated, with abundant natural light, loft-like openness, and a distinct sense of warmth and character. Large glass doors open directly to the backyard, creating a seamless connection between the interior and the outdoor space. This home offers 4 bedrooms and 3 full bathrooms, including a spa-like bath with a steam shower. A skylit staircase leads to the second floor where 3 bedrooms and 2 full bathrooms are bathed in natural light from 4 additional skylights, while the lower level includes a newly built fourth bedroom with natural light windows, laundry, and additional flexible space ideal for a gym, playroom, studio, media room, or storage. Outside, a large private backyard creates a true urban retreat, with room for dining, lounging, and entertaining, plus a rustic seasonal cottage that adds charm and flexibility. One of the home’s best features is its setting. It feels tucked away on a quieter street, just off the park, while still placing you at the crossroads of the best of North Brooklyn. McCarren Park, Domino Park, Williamsburg Waterfront, Bedford Avenue, the Bedford Av L station, and Greenpoint are all close at hand, giving the home a rare balance of privacy, walkability, and immediate access to everything that makes the neighborhood so vibrant. With the added convenience of a new supermarket opening one block away at Driggs and North 11th, the location can't be beat! A true oasis in the middle of Williamsburg. As an added bonus, the property sits on a 20’ x 89’ lot and benefits from M1-2/R6A, MX-8 zoning, offering additional long-term flexibility and potential for future repositioning, expansion, or redevelopment. Protected Tax Class Property: only $4,400 per year!
